Job Description

Plant manager is responsible for the overall performance of the plant in accordance with the contract between Veolia and the Client. The Plant Manager will oversee operations and maintenance ensuring the safe, compliant, cost effective, profitable, efficient and reliable operation of the facility

Main Responsibilities:

SAFETY

Plant manager is responsible for establishing and maintaining a strong safety culture among the employees working at the plant. In particular the plant manager is responsible for:

1. Ensuring that all activities performed at the plant are completed safely and in accordance with the safety standards of Veolia.
2.





Promoting activities finalized to improve the safety culture and the safety of all activities performed at the plant.
3. Planning the required training for compliant and safe operations
4. Ensuring all incidents, accidents and near misses are reported in accordance with the Veolia procedures.
5. Organizing and if required, leading investigation on unsafe acts and incidents The plant manager will receive support and guidance from specialized safety advisors, but he/she is ultimately the person responsible for the safety performance of the plant/contract.

PROFIT AND LOSS MANAGEMENT

Plant manager is responsible for the financial performance of the plant/contract. The plant manager is also responsible for:

1. The preparation of the required budgets and forecasts in accordance with the requirements of Veolia, providing suitable explanations supporting the proposed numbers.
2. Producing all the required information on the financial performance of the plant/contract: this includes accruals, explanations, documentation and reporting on a regular basis (typically monthly).
3.





Investigating and explaining financial performance which are deviating from the expected baseline, proposing improvement plans and strategies when required.
4. Researching, planning, targeting and controlling reductions in costs of operations.
5. Monitoring and approving site expenditures,

The plant manager will receive support and guidance from the finance department, however he/she is ultimately the person responsible for the financial performance of the plant/contract.

CLIENT AND CONTRACT MANAGEMENT

Plant manager is responsible to ensure the Veolia plant operations are meeting all the contractual requirements. The plant manager is also responsible for:

1. Creating regular reports required by the client/contract to be shared and updated.
2.





Communicating with the client in relation to day to day activities and contract requirements
3. Preparing invoices in accordance with the contract in a timely and accurate manner.
4. Ensuring Veolia entitlement under the contracts are met by the clients.
5. Establishing a strong collaborative relationship with the clients and their representatives.

OPERATION AND MAINTENANCE OF THE PLANT

Plant manager is responsible for the efficient, safe and compliant operations and maintenance of the plant in accordance with the contract. The plant manager is responsible for:

1. Establishing, reviewing, perfecting and documenting operating procedures
2. Ensuring adequate staffing levels at all times
3.





Leading the maintenance manager and his/her team with clear directions and objectives based on plant, client and contract requirements.
4. Developing the required LT asset management plan to ensure operational continuity during the lifespan of the project
5. Providing strong leadership to the operations team to achieve all objectives.
6. Ensuring practices and procedures comply with regulations, codes and standards
7. Understanding the fundamentals of the plant design and process to ensure efficient performance of the operations.
8. Being available, in person or on the phone, to advise and direct the team when taking critical decisions during the different shifts of operations.

EMPLOYEE MANAGEMENT

Plant manager is responsible for the effective,





compliant and foresight management of the people working at the plant. In particular the plant manager is responsible for:

1. Monitoring and approving employees timesheet, vacations and other benefits.
2. Defining and communicating SMART goals and objectives for all personnel reporting directly and indirectly to the plant manager. Regularly assessing the performance of the employees to help them better achieve their defined goals.
3. Assessessing and assisting in upgrading the supervisory and operators talent and skills bases to achieve growth and meet objectives such as reduced cost, efficient, improved maintenance and reliable delivery.
4. Developing succession plans and leads plant hiring and training choices.
5.





Defining and communicating as required roles and responsibilities of the employees which are part of the plant O&M; team.
6. Ensuring required training is organized in a timely manner.
7. Coaching operation supervisors to become expert in their job and good leaders of the people they manage.

RISK MANAGEMENT

Plant manager is responsible for the implementation of risk management initiatives to mitigate all major risks potentially affecting the plant and or the contract. In particular:

1. Carrying out regular risk assessments to identify major risks, performing qualitative and quantitative analysis to determine how the identified risks could affect the plant or the project
2. Proposing suitable actions to mitigate the identified risk prioritizing those with bigger impact.
3. Involving other stakeholders (management,





technical department, client, etc) to plant and implement agreed control measures.
4. Developing a Business Continuity Management Plan
5. Monitoring progress of improvement and generating suitable documentation.

OTHER RESPONSIBILITIES:

1. Leading subcontracting choices and managing subcontractors in accordance with Veolia policies and procedures
2. Ensuring all environmental requirements of the plant and the contract are met in accordance with Veolia policies and procedures.
3. Driving continuous improvements in all aspects of plant performance.
4.





Providing Veolia management with regular and accurate reporting on the performance of the plant and of the contract
5. Attending or leading meetings to show clear participation of Management in key initiatives.
6. Participating in the broader Veolia, as required
